Marine mooring is a ship state, including the ties of docks, floating cylinders, or other mooring boats, mooring line required, relying on cable to fix the boat. The mooring bollard refers to the bollard fixed on the deck or the pier to tie the cable. It is generally made through metal casting or welding. Because it is very stressed when used, the base is very firm. In order to prevent the cable from slipping, the bollard is generally covered with a bollard cap which is slightly larger than the pile. The bollards are usually mounted on the front of the bow, the stern of the ship.
The mooring bollard has a specific shape. After thriving into the water, it can quickly engage the bottom to generate the grasping force. The vessel or other floating system is left to the special appliance of the designated water via anchor chain or anchor cable. A first anchor is installed on the outside of the ship's left and right bulldone, another anchor of the same specification is placed at the deck for spare use.
There are various types of marine bollards, including curved dock bollard, cruciform bollard, double cruciform bollard, double bitt mooring bollard, kidney-shaped bollard, staghorn bollard also known as twin horn dock bollard, T head bollard.
Arrangement Requirements Of Mooring Bollard
The piles which provide cable assistance for dragging, are arranged in the front and stern and the direction should be consistent with the cable dragging direction. The chock and the fairlead should be maintained at a certain distance, which should not be less than 6 times the diameter of the mooring bollard for a large vessel and not less than 10 times the diameter for a small ship, generally within the range of 1.5 ~ 2.5m, to provide enough deck for mooring assistance rope, no obstacle allowed within 1m around the bollard, and the distance between the outer edge of the bollard and the gunnel should not be less than 1.5 times the diameter of the mooring bollard.

When the inflatable life raft is used, the raft and the storage cartridge can be thrown directly into the water. The life raft can be automatically inflated. When the ship sank too fast under the water, it is too late to throw it into the water surface. The hydrostatic pressure release on the raft will automatically remove and the emergency inflatable life raft will be released, floated automatically.
The detailed steps as follows
1.Take the hook opening on the hydrostatic pressure release and launch the small ring, making the chain hook fall, or rotating the manual release device, and the raft will slide to the sea.
2.When the height is less than 11m from the water surface, or when the raft is thrown into the water, it is necessary to continue to pull out the first cable and open the valve of the inflatable cylinder, so that the raft is floated above the seawater.
3.If there is an overturned state, it should be centered. The person should wear a life jacket, and climb the bottom of the raft. When standing in the steel bottle, the hands pull the bottom, squatting and hypokinesis.
The Installation Of Inflatable Life Raft
When the inflatable life raft is folded, it is stored in the glass steel storage cartridge. Generally, it is generally arranged on the two-port boards. When installing, the raft is welded to the ship deck, ensuring that the storage cartridge is in the hierarchical position, and the fix is with the kundy which is connected to the raft and the manual detachment assembly. The assembly components are connected to the hydrostatic pressure release.
1. The bowline that is taken from the life-saving raft cylinder, is firmly connected to the hydrostatic pressure release ring, and there is an easy-to-break rope on the connecting ring, and the other end of the easy-to-break rope should be connected in the hydrostatic pressure release.
2. It is not allowed to pull the bowline from the storage cartridge.
What Should Be Paid Attention To The Use Of Inflatable Life Raft
1. When the life raft is drifting too urgently, the sea anchor can be put into water and reduce the rafting speed.
2. in order to avoid the wind and waves, the enter-exit door should be put down, and the duty for looking out will be strengthened through the hoping window on the raft hanger.
3. If there is water in the raft, take out the water scoop from the repair bag and drain it with the absorbent sponge.
4.In the night, using the flashlight to emit a Mousta signal, during the day, the mirror is transmitted by the sunlight.
5. When it is raining, utilize the drinking water bottle and the water pipe and deposit the rainwater to prepare for drinking.

Super Cell Rubber Fender (SC Type)
Super cell rubber fender is one of the most proven and reliable marine fender styles ever designed and historically has been the most commonly used fender in the industry. The fender originally is designed to replace the cylindrical fender which has more than 30 years of record of accomplishment with only some minor improvements over the years.
They are designed to absorb the collision energy between ship and dock at the time of berthing for berths, dolphin wharf, offshore docks, and terminals. Cell fender geometrical shape gives it sturdiness, shear resistance, compact structure and the capacity to absorb energy equally from all directions. The cylindrical-buckling column absorbs axial loads efficiently and buckles radially. To distribute the reaction force, they are typically supplied with large fender panels, which keep the hull pressure low. The large mounting flanges serve to distribute the super cell rubber fender loading over the back of the fender panel frame and allow easy installation of the mounting bolts. It is designed to deflect in an axial direction.
Features
Reasonable structure
High energy absorption and low reaction force
Excellent under berthing angle and shear
Suitable for a large wharf
Super Cone Rubber Fender (ZC type)
The super cone rubber fender is also known as ZC type rubber fender. Cone fender is one of the most efficient rubber fender types. The super cone rubber fender is updated generation of cell rubber fender with excellent energy absorption and low reaction force. The structure of the fender is more reasonable. Owing to its unique conical fender structure, it always has excellent performance under different berthing conditions especially where large berthing angles and heavy impacts need to be accommodated. The conical body shape makes the fender very stable even at large compression angles. The deflection can reach 70%, and the equal specification fender energy absorbs raise one more time with long life using. The fender can reduce the cost of the dock project. While vessel angular berthing, the performance unchanged.
They are fully rubber-embedded mounting flanges. Usually closed box steel panel mounting with UHMW-PE plastic pads is an important part of a complete super cone rubber fender system. Fender frontal panel can lower the surface pressure of vessel sideboard and low friction UHMW-PE plastic pads to lower shear loading between fender and vessel to extend the service life of the fender. The Cone fender comes in a wide range of standard sizes, can meet mufti-berthing conditions.
Features
Outstanding energy absorption to reaction force ratio (E/R)
High shear stability
Reducing the pressure during berthing
No loss of performance up to 10° approach angle
Anchor recesses for easier installation
Cylindrical Rubber Fender (Y Type)
The cylindrical rubber fender also named Y type rubber fender can often be installed at less cost than types having equal energy capacity. It offers a means of lower fendering costs when there is a large variation in the size of the incoming vessels. The rubber fender has a very long history due to simple design and easy installation, which makes these units an economical solution for remote locations and for multi-user berths where vessel type cannot always be predicted. The progressive load-deflection characteristics make it suitable for both large and small vessels, with a wide choice of sizes and diameter ratios. The type of marine rubber fender is available in an outside diameter up to 1600 mm and inside diameter ranging from 75 to 800 mm, variable in length up to 5500mm. It is applied for longitudinal and crosswise sway of ships while berthing at the dock and widely used for the ships with different sizes and different docks.
The installation of the cylindrical rubber fender is simple by using chains, bars, ropes or specially designed ladder brackets, depending on the fender size and substructure. There are several different installation methods available for different sizes, small cylindrical rubber fenders, typically up to 600mm OD, are suspended with chains through their bore connected to brackets or U-anchors each end. With small tidal ranges, they are usually mounted horizontally. In large tidal ranges, small cylindrical rubber fenders can be diagonally slung. Large cylindrical rubber fenders up to 1600mm OD are usually suspended using central bars with chain supports at each end connecting back to wall brackets or U-anchors. For very heavy duty applications and for fenders above 1600mm OD, ladder brackets mounting systems are recommended. The cylindrical rubber fender can be provided in specified lengths and the ends can be beveled.
Features
Low reaction force and small surface pressure.
reasonable energy absorption.
Suitable to rolling and pitching of berthing vessels.

Yokohama Pneumatic Rubber Fender
The Yokohama pneumatic fender is a bumper with air as bumping media. Impact energy is absorbed by compressed air so that the ship can berth softly to protect the ship from bumping. The rubber fender is widely used for oil tankers, container vessels, yachts, ocean platforms, large wharf and naval ports, etc. It is suitable for ship berthing of all directions and has been widely used in many types of ship berthing in ports. It has various sizes of D0.5m*L1m – D4.5m*L12m. It can be protected by tire net chains and can be also used without the tire net as well.
It can easily be deflated which allows simple and cost-effective relocation and re-commissioning in other locations. Pneumatic rubber fenders have the merits of high-pressure resistance, high-energy absorption low reaction, aging resistance and saltwater corrosion resistance. They support berthing at angles up to 15 degrees for oil tankers, container vessels, bulwark carriers, yachts, ocean platforms, large wharf and naval ports, etc. We have two types of molded pneumatic fenders: pneumatic rubber fenders equipped with chain-tire-net wildly used for ship to ship transfer operations and hydro pneumatic fenders equipped with counterweight and ballast water designed for a submarine berth, which can be installed vertically. The ISO 17357:2014 compliant chain-tire net pneumatic fender (CTN) is a lattice of used tires connected by a network of horizontal and vertical chains, which adds further protection to the fender body. The chains are galvanized for greater corrosion resistance and covered by rubber sleeves to prevent abrasive damage to the outer rubber. The horizontal chains are fastened at each end to a ring shackle. The rubber fenders are supplied with two different inside pressure levels to cover a wide performance range, 50kPa & 80kPa.
Features
1. High strength and friction resistance.
2. High energy absorption with a low reaction force.
3. Adjusted performance by varying internal pressure.
4. Low and easy maintenance.
5. Low transportation costs - pneumatic fenders can be deflated and folded for transport.
6. Easily deflatable to be used in a different location and to be stored on deck.

Marine anchors can act as drogues (positive drag mechanism) for ships and other such vessels during storms. They provide a restoring drag that keeps the vessel stable and steady and prevents slamming of the bow or flooding through green water loading during unsteady conditions.
Danforth Anchor
The Danforth is a lightweight, cheap and easily storable design that uses two triangular blades or flukes attached to the shank to hook or dig into the ocean bed. The gap between the flukes allows for the Danforth anchor to grip onto debris and rocks instead of simply acting as a sail against the water currents. Also, the shank and flukes are hinged, so that the orientation of the flukes can be changed depending on the type of material on the seafloor.
Stockless Anchor
Stockless anchor is a normal type of stockless anchor with a small ball on a fluke. With the stockless design, it fits the anchor pocket perfectly. It is commonly used in commercial vessels and recreational craft. It is made high quality cast carbon steel and is a great mooring device for fishing boats due to the large holding power and easy storage.
Spek Anchor
Spek anchor is one type of the stockless anchor. It is the improved anchor with a lower point of gravity from the hall anchor, whose core of anchor head is located in the center of the pin centerline to the bottom. The structure of spek anchor is characterized that there is anchor crown plate and reinforcing ribs at the anchor crown. The anchor claw is easy to turn to the ground and then has a better stability. The smart design makes it a perfect fit for the anchor pocket.
Bruce Claw Anchor
This type of bruce claw anchor is commonly referred to as the claw because of its shape and design. It is used to hook into the rocks at the bottom of the ocean and then settle in. However, it does not work when the material at the bottom is loose sand, silt or mud. Also, weeds and other structures can entangle the claw of the anchor without providing any actual anchoring force. Instead, they tend to impede the recovery of the anchor when it is time for the vessel to move on.
Other types of equipment that are used in conjunction with an anchor to hold down a vessel or installation floating on the surface of the water include riggings (such as trip lines), anchor chains and ropes, stowage equipment, etc. Anchor chains and ropes are an important factor in determining the reliability of a given anchor since these provide the only connection between the structure and anchor. They must be able to withstand tremendous amounts of force both in tension and contraction. Similarly, trip lines must also be strong enough to apply force on the anchor to orient it in a particular direction.

Does your marine have an anchor? If so, is it of sufficient size and strength to hold your marine in place? Believe it or not, many marine owners decide on which anchor to buy based on convenience and storage space. Before you select a marine anchor, read these tips to get started making the best choice.
Weight
Bigger is better when choosing anchor weight. You won’t need as much for holding the marine in a quiet cove, but you will need much more weight for an emergency situation in the wind. You can also carry two anchors of differing weights. A smaller “lunch hook” is adequate for short anchorages in calm water when you will be keeping watch on the anchor. You’ll also want to have a larger “working anchor” for overnight trips or when going ashore in gusty winds. Using two differing anchor styles can also be beneficial, especially with high-profile marines like pontoons.
Bottom conditions
Holding power and weight is only as good as the anchor’s ability to penetrate the bottom. Anchors easily penetrate hard sand bottoms, which offer consistent holding power. You get less in mud, which the anchor must penetrate to reach a harder secondary bottom material. Anchor weight is more important than design in difficult grassy bottoms.
Holding power
It might make sense to choose an anchor based on the weight of the marine. However, anchors are rated by their holding power, or the amount of pull force the anchor must withstand to hold the marine in place. Holding power is formulated based on environmental factors, like wind speed. As a general rule, holding power of 90 pounds is sufficient for safely anchoring a 20' marine in winds up to 20 mph. For the same wind speed, a holding power of 125 pounds is adequate for a 25' marine. This is why high holding power anchors that rely strictly on their weight—such as a space-saving, plastic-coated 10-pound mushroom anchor—are only capable of generating more than twice their weight in holding power. A 20' fiberglass bass marine using a 20-pound anchor will always drag if the design is the only buying consideration.

Fluke
Danforth anchors, are the top choice for most marines with overall lengths of 30' or less. Fluke anchors provide sufficient holding power considering their small size. By design, they fold flat and are easy to stow in storage compartments. The anchor arm, or stock, buries itself after the pointed flukes dig into the bottom. For those reasons, fluke anchors are best in hard sand and mud. The flukes can’t penetrate rocky bottoms and are not recommended for slick, grassy bottoms. Loose mud or clay can foul the flukes and prevent bottom penetration.
Navy
The Navy anchor gets the nod for filling in for what the fluke anchor lacks. Navy anchors have long stocks and distinct arks and flukes. They are ideal for heavy grass, weeds and rocky bottoms where one arm can take hold of a crevice.
Claw
Claw anchors have great holding power for their size. Modeled after oil-rig anchors in the turbulent North Sea, the downsized marineing version sets effortlessly and holds in a variety of bottoms. Claw anchors are ideal for the windy conditions for which they are designed. They will hold no matter how much the marine swings around on the hook. Claw anchors are the obvious choice for large, open bodies of water.
Spek
Spek anchor is one type of the stockless anchor. It is the improved anchor with a lower point of gravity from the hall anchor, whose core of anchor head is located in the center of the pin centerline to the bottom. The structure of spek anchor is characterized that there is anchor crown plate and reinforcing ribs at the anchor crown. The anchor claw is easy to turn to the ground and then has a better stability. The smart design makes it a perfect fit for the anchor pocket. And the anchor flukes will keep naturally upwards and overturn immediately when touching the hull plate to avoid damaging the shell plating.
TW Type
The TW type pool HHP anchor has more than 2 times holding power than the conventional anchor of the same weight. The anchor has large flat flukes made out of high tensile steel plate material. The thickness varies from 15 mm up to 140 mm depending on the anchor size. It allows a weight reduction of 25% compared to a conventional anchor for the same equipment number It has a fully balanced type and unbalanced type. The fully balanced type always has its flukes in a vertical position while lifting the anchor. The unbalanced type will tip over to one side.
Mushroom
Ideal for canoes, kayaks and jon marines, the mushroom anchor works best in soft bottoms, where it creates penetration based on suction. Makes a decent lunch hook anchor, but is not recommended as the primary anchor.

Marine watertight doors are available in aluminum, steel or a combination of these metals meeting IMO, SOLAS requirements. It can be opened and closed quickly and lightly. It is used for bulkheads with water tightness requirements. It can prevent the ingress of water from one compartment to another during flooding or accidents and therefore act as a safety barrier.
It limits the spread of water inside the vessel. These doors are used onboard in many ships such as in the fore and aft passageways underdeck and in engine room bulkheads leading to shaft tunnels in container vessels, large passenger ships, offshore vessels, oil exploration vessels.
They are used in areas where the chances of flooding are high. Areas such as engine room compartments and shaft tunnel and some of such places.
Therefore it is important that crew members are familiar with the system as well as the location of different powered watertight doors aboard the ship.
Watertight as defined in SOLAS is: capable of preventing the passage of water in any direction under the head of water likely to occur in intact and damaged conditions.
Weathertight is defined as that in any sea conditions water will not penetrate the ship.
To make it simpler, a watertight door can prevent the passage of water in both directions when subjected to ahead of water i.e it can withstand water pressure from both sides. They are designed to withstand continuous submersion and are therefore located below the waterline like shaft tunnels, ballast tanks, bow thruster compartments, etc. all openings below the waterline have to be watertight.
Watertight Doors Drill on Ships
1. Drills for the operation of watertight doors shall take place every week. Also, the doors should be checked before leaving the port.
2. All watertight doors, both hinged and power operated should be operated daily during the rounds.
3. The door should be able to operate from both local and remote places. i.e. bridge and ship control center.
4. If the door is operated from a remote location, there should be an audio and visual alarm during the closing
5. There should be an indication of both open and close on the remote place of operation.
Maintenance of Watertight Doors
The ship’s planned maintenance system must be followed for carrying out routine inspection and maintenance on watertight doors which should include the correct functioning of the whole system and specifically:
Warning devices and alarms
The electric/hydraulic mechanism
Valves
Fluid level indicators
Seals
Lights

A marine anchor is an indispensable device for ensuring ship safety, which is used to stabilize the ship when the ship is not parked or mooring without a buoy. When some ships enter the berthing area, the anchor will be thrown into the water for steady berthing.
Why Marine Anchor Used For Smooth Boat Berthing
How does an anchor can stabilize a ship? Because the anchor is sinking to the bottom, which will generate a huge grasp force, and the gravity of the marine anchor chain itself is large enough. The ship will be fixed.
When the ship needs to be temporarily moored, the ship anchor will be thrown out. An extra length of the anchor chain will be put to more close to the bottom of the sea. As the anchor is slowly sinking, the fluke of the anchor will have contact with the underwater bottom. At the same time, the anchor fluke under the seabed will be subject to a horizontal tension force. Under the dual role of tension force and gravity, the anchor is slowly inserted into the seaside, which is getting stronger and ensures stable berthing and water safety.
The anchor chain is also very important, the total weight of the anchor chain is much larger than the anchor. The length or the anchor chain is several times larger than the water depth, and there is a relatively long anchor chain is lying on the water bottom, and the underwater also has a great friction resistance to the anchor chain.
How To Select The Anchorage
When the boat anchor is thrown, the boat cannot be started and control normally and will be drifting everywhere, so a safe and suitable anchorage should be selected before throwing, surveying its topography and choosing the appropriate mooring area.
The selected anchorage ground should have the appropriate water depth, no large waves, good shielding.
1. When the anchor station is selected in the deepwater area, the largest water depth of the anchorage generally does not exceed 1/4 of the total length of the anchor chain. Otherwise, the anchorage grasps will be affected.
2. The geological and terrain of the anchorage should be good, with moderate soft and hard bottom and clayey seabed, so that the anchor grasp force is better.
3. It is best that the terrain around the anchorage can provide a natural barrier to the vessel, which makes the anchor to get better into the underwater bottom, becoming more secure, so that the ship has stable berthing.
4. The anchorage should also be away from the channel, the water area and there is no cable below.
Main Types Of Marine Anchor
1. Danforth anchor
Danforth anchor is the first generation of high holding power anchors and belongs to stockless anchors with a large grasping weight ratio and rodent area. The gripping bottom is deep and numerous, and the grasping force is extremely large. But the anchor fluke is easily broken and the storage is inconvenient, not suitable for transportation boats.
2.Bohr anchor
The Bohr anchor is also called TW type anchor or N type anchor. It has more than 2 times the holding power of the conventional anchor of the same weight. The anchor has large flat flukes made out of high tensile steel plate material. It is used as a bow anchor when sailing.
It is designed to fit into small anchor pockets on modern ships and the hollow flukes are welded from two plates to create strong anchoring performance under various circumstances.
3.Hall anchor
Hall anchor is also known as the mountain anchor, which is a stockless HHP anchor, free to rotate, inclined to stock. The anchor head and the anchor fluke are a whole casting. When a lying anchor is contacted with the underwater bottom through any side of the anchor, the resistance generated by the anchor head strip friction discharge soil is forced to generate the grasp force of the anchor.
4.Spek anchor
The Spek anchor is a modified Hall anchor. Plate and reinforcing rib are installed at the anchor crown. Therefore, the fluke of the anchor is easy to turn to the ground with high stability and when stores the anchor, the anchor fluke naturally facing up. Moreover, in contact with the boat shell, it will not damage the boat shell plate.
5.AC-14 anchor
AC-14 anchor is a stockless HHP anchor with a wide anchor crown, thick and long flukes, and longitudinal ribs. It is available in a self-colored finish or in a galvanized finish. Its design provides excellent weight to performance ratios. The lighter weight which is 25% weight reduction compared to conventional anchors and high holding power makes it good stability and then it is commonly used as the main anchor on large container ships, supertankers. It has an excellent performance in a variety of soils.
